Eco-distillery Cooper King launches Sharing Selection Boxes for Christmas

Yorkshire’s Cooper King Distillery has created a choice of two Sharing Selection Boxes for eco-conscious spirit lovers and not only do they fit through a letterbox, but the spirits are distilled with locally grown grain and botanicals and delivered in Forest Stewardship Council certified cardboard boxes.

Cooper King’s letterbox-friendly choice of two Sharing Selection boxes each contain three 100ml glass bottles of small-batch premium gin, gin liqueur, vodka or new-make malt spirit, complete with tasting notes, serving suggestions and a QR code to guided tasting videos – all beautifully packaged in a box designed by local Yorkshire artist, Emily Stubbs and inspired by Cooper King’s ancestry.

Choose from a box containing the Distillery’s award-winning Dry Gin, Herb Gin and Berry & Basil Gin Liqueur, or the box featuring Skosh Smoked & Spiced Dry Gin, Black Cardamom Botanical Vodka and New-Make Malt Spirit. The boxes are £25 from Cooperkingdistillery.co.uk.

The sustainability-minded can relax in the knowledge that Cooper King Distillery runs on 100% green energy, one of only a handful in the country to do so. It also has its own on-site beehives and a botanical garden to produce its own honey, basil and lemongrass, with spent botanicals and barley sent to a local bakery to be upcycled into delicious breads or fed to local cattle. Zero waste is sent to landfill.

Abbie Neilson, head distiller and distillery co-founder says: “The Sharing Selection boxes are a special gift experience for spirits lovers that can be delivered easily during the pandemic, while ensuring we continue to tread lightly on the planet and respond to the increasing demand for eco-conscious gifts.”
